Sabrina Ghayour: Persiana Easy

November 15 @ 4:00 pm - 6:00 pm

Step into a world of spice, soul and sensational cooking with Sabrina Ghayour – the award-winning British-Iranian chef, Sunday Times bestselling author and beloved food writer hailed by the Observer as the “golden girl of Persian cookery”. Known for her bold, vibrant flavours and no-fuss approach, Sabrina has transformed the way we cook and eat Middle Eastern food at home.

In this joyful, appetite-whetting event, she introduces her latest book Persiana Easy – a celebration of unfussy recipes packed with flavour. From smoky aubergine dishes to saffron stews and sticky, irresistible desserts, these are meals you can throw together on a weeknight but that taste like a feast. Low on obscure ingredients and unnecessary steps – just clever, comforting dishes you’ll return to again and again.

With trademark humour and charm, Sabrina shares kitchen stories, essential tips, and the journey behind her much-loved Persiana series – one of the most successful and enduring Middle Eastern cookbooks of the last decade.

Whether you’re a seasoned cook or just dipping in your spoon, this is an event to ignite your culinary imagination. A perfect Saturday afternoon treat in the heart of Folkestone.

Folkestone Book Festival is our annual celebration of books, bold ideas and the power of storytelling – by the sea. Curated by award-winning author and journalist Sophie Haydock (The Flames, Madame Matisse), this year’s programme features more than 50 events over 11 days, bringing together world-class writers, radical thinkers and unforgettable conversations – all inspired by Folkestone’s spirit of enabling creativity and transformative change.

We want the festival to be for everyone. That’s why we’ve introduced a £5 ticket – a no-questions-asked option for anyone who might be struggling to afford events.

And if you’re planning to come to more than a handful of events, don’t miss our great-value Festival Pass, which gives you access to all events (excluding classes, which need to be booked separately) for just £140.
